What the numbers show

Beneficiary incidence in 5th quintile (richest) (%) - Unconditional Cash Transfers -rural is currently reported for 27 countries. The highest value is 40.2% in Uruguay; the lowest is 0.7% in Türkiye.

The median across all reporting countries is 10.3%, and the mean is 11.2%.

The gap between the highest and lowest reporting country is a factor of about 60.

Over the past decade 15 countries rose and 11 fell. The largest increase was in Serbia (up 176.6%), and the largest decrease in Türkiye (down 94.6%).
